How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Emeryville?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Emeryville Studio Apartments with Rent Specials | $2,191 | $765 | $5,043 |
| Emeryville 1 Bedroom Apartments with Rent Specials | $2,702 | $950 | $6,842 |
| Emeryville 2 Bedroom Apartments with Rent Specials | $3,041 | $999 | $9,325 |
| Emeryville 3 Bedroom Apartments with Rent Specials | $3,700 | $775 | $9,912 |
| Emeryville 4 Bedroom Apartments with Rent Specials | $3,109 | $1,550 | $6,785 |
| Emeryville 5 Bedroom Apartments | $3,519 | $1,450 | $10,000+ |
